DENVER - A New York City imam accused of lying to officials investigating a terrorism plot was ordered held without bail on Monday, moments before a father and son in Denver were in court on similar charges. Ahmad Afzali smiled and waved at relatives as deputy marshals led him out of federal court Monday in Brooklyn. His attorney, Ron Kuby, said he’ll seek bail for the 37-year-old Afzali on Thursday.
